Where does “snabbspola” come from?

snabbspola (Swedish) comes from Swedish spola, from Middle Low German spölen, from Proto-West Germanic spōlijan, from Proto-Indo-European pleh₃(w)- — to swim, flow.

snabbspola (Swedish): to fast forward
